Digi-Sense® ThermoLogR®
RTD Logging Thermometer
- Log up to 1000 readings in real time
- Transfer data to an infrared printer or computer via the optional infrared RS-232 adapter
- Displays temperatures in °F or °C
- Great for on-site documentation
- Simultaneously monitor current, minimum, and maximum readings
|
Transfer data to an infrared printer or to your computer via the optional infrared RS-232 adapter. Simultaneously monitor current, minimum, and maximum readings. CAL button enables you to field calibrate the meter. Other features include selectable °F/°C and HOLD function.
Thermometer conforms to DIN IEC 751 revised to ITS-90. IP54-rated housing consists of a rugged ABS plastic case and silicone membrane keypad. Built-in stand allows easy benchtop use. Alpha coefficient: 0.003850 ohm/ohm/°C or 0.003916 ohm/ohm/°C selectable.
| Specifications |
|
| Type |
RTD |
| Range |
-330 to 2210°F (-201 to 1210°C) |
| Resolution |
0.01°F/°C from 99.99 to 99.99°F/°C; 0.1°F/°C from 100.0 to 330°F/°C and from 100.0 to 999.9°F/°C 1°F/°C above 1000°F/°C |
| Accuracy |
±0.06°F (±0.03°C) from 99.99 to 99.99°F/°C; ±0.1°F/°C from 100.0 to 330°F/°C and 100.0 to 999.9°F/°C; ±1°F/°C above 1000°F/°C |
| Input connector |
one 100 ohm platinum RTD with three-pin connector (not included) |
| Display |
three 4-digit displays; 0.4"H and 0.2"H |
| Power |
two AA batteries (included); battery life approx. 300 hours |
| Probe |
round, 3-pin connector (not included) |
| Dimensions |
3.3"W x 6.2"H x 1.2"D |

Handheld Immersion Probe
Features a rigid stainless steel sheath with 1/8 diameter. Used in liquids or gases. Our most popular probe for general useage. Max. temp. 392°F |

Handheld Penetration Probe
Use for liquids, semi-solids and core temperatures in a variety of materials.1/8 diameter stainless steel shaft is drawn to a point for easy insertion. Popular in foods, rubber and plastic. Max. temp. 392°F. |

Handheld Air or Gas Probe
The stainless steel shaft is open ended with a ventilation hole provided in the sides to expose the bare RTD sensor to the outside for faster measurements of air or gases. Ideal for environmental readings, cold storage or HVAC work. Max. temp. 392°F. |

Handheld Surface Probe
Stainless steel stem with a spring loaded sensing tip. Tripod supports help to position the sensor flat against the surface being measured. Class B sensor. Max. temp. 392°F. |

Between Pack Probe
Rigid stainless steel sheath is flattened for insertion between packages of produce, frozen foods or other products. Slips easily between cartons or plastic bagged products. The tip is rounded to minimize accidental penetration of packaging materials. Max. temp. 392°F. |

Air/Gas Wire Probe
Designed for HVAC work, cabinets, temperature chambers and environmental measurements. Small stainless steel shaft is ventilated for fast response. The 39 cable is PTFE/FEP insulated. Max. temp. 392°F. |
